Applications:
TAED is mainly applied in laundry
detergents as bleach activator to improve the washing
performance.Such as automatic dish washing, bleach boosters,
laundry soak treatments. TAED applied in textile bleaching to
react with hydrogen peroxide in the bleach bath to produce a
stronger oxidant. The use of TAED as bleach activator enables
bleaching at lower process ?temperatures and PH conditions.In
pulp and paper industry, TAED is suggested to react with
hydrogen peroxide to form a pulp bleaching solution. The
addition of TAED into pulp bleaching solution results in a
satisfactory bleaching effect.
